On behalf of our esteemed client, a leading entity in the automotive industry, we are currently seeking candidates for a contract position. This opportunity is available immediately as a contractual role until 31st March 2026, with potential for extension.

The Data Reporting Analyst is primarily responsible for both leading and contributing to the design, development and support of enterprise reporting as well as the supporting the business with self-service reporting capabilities.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ain and update Report Development Standards and related policies and procedures to achieve and maintain best practice in terms of quality, long-term cost and re-use.
  • Contribute to the design, development and support of Enterprise Reporting in line with Report Development Standards leveraging programming where necessary.
  • Monitor and Report on performance of Enterprise Reporting against targets and recommends countermeasures where required in order to ensure that agreed objectives can be achieved.
  • Coordinates and facilitates forums to ensure that reporting and analytics plans, progress and issues are clearly communicated to all business stakeholders and understood and documented in accordance with relevant business processes and business logic.

Qualification / Experience:

  • Degree qualification in IT or equivalent experience desired.
  • Experience and applied knowledge of Microsoft Fabric, Power BI and Excel.
  • 5+ years' accumulative IT industry experience required.
  • Familiar with industry standard project methodologies and working closely with business users.
  • Experience in leading mixed-vendor project teams to deliver optimal business outcomes.
  • Understanding of SAP Business Objects, HANA, Analysis for Office (AFO) technologies.
  • Proven track record of managing business stakeholders with competing priorities.
  • Proven budget management experience and financial acumen.
